1. What is the Current Status of Switzerland’s Tourism Reopening?
Switzerland has been gradually reopening its borders to tourism, adjusting its entry requirements based on the evolving global health situation. The country lifted most of its COVID-19 related entry restrictions in May 2022, welcoming travelers from all countries without requiring proof of vaccination, recovery, or testing. However, it’s always wise to stay updated on the latest travel guidelines before your trip.
Switzerland’s reopening strategy has been praised for its balanced approach, prioritizing public health while recognizing the importance of tourism for the economy. According to a report by the Swiss Federal Statistical Office, the tourism sector contributes significantly to the country’s GDP, making its recovery crucial.
2. What are the Current Entry Requirements for Tourists Visiting Switzerland?
Currently, there are no COVID-19 related entry restrictions for tourists entering Switzerland. This means that travelers from all countries can enter Switzerland without providing proof of vaccination, recovery, or a negative test.
However, it is essential to note that entry requirements can change, and it’s always best to check the official website of the State Secretariat for Migration (SEM) or the Federal Office of Public Health (FOPH) for the most up-to-date information before your trip.

5. What are the Best Times to Visit Switzerland for Tourism?
The best time to visit Switzerland depends on your interests and preferences.
- Summer (June to August): Ideal for hiking, outdoor activities, and exploring the Swiss Alps.
- Winter (December to February): Perfect for skiing, snowboarding, and other winter sports.
- Spring (March to May) and Autumn (September to November): Offer pleasant weather and fewer crowds, making them great for sightseeing and cultural experiences.
According to Switzerland Tourism, the shoulder seasons (spring and autumn) often provide the best balance of favorable weather and fewer tourists, allowing for a more relaxed and enjoyable travel experience.

9. What is the Swiss Travel Pass and How Can it Benefit Tourists?
The Swiss Travel Pass is an all-in-one ticket that allows unlimited travel on Switzerland’s public transportation network, including trains, buses, and boats. It also provides free admission to over 500 museums and attractions and discounts on various mountain excursions.
The Swiss Travel Pass can be a great value for tourists who plan to travel extensively throughout Switzerland. It eliminates the need to purchase individual tickets for each journey and provides access to a wide range of attractions.
According to the Swiss Federal Railways (SBB), the Swiss Travel Pass is particularly cost-effective for travelers who plan to take multiple train journeys and visit several museums or attractions.
10. What are Some Popular Events and Festivals in Switzerland?
Switzerland hosts a variety of events and festivals throughout the year, showcasing its culture, traditions, and natural beauty. Some popular events and festivals include:
- Carnival in Lucerne (February/March): A lively celebration with parades, costumes, and music.
- Sechseläuten in Zurich (April): A traditional spring festival featuring a parade and the burning of the Böögg, a snowman effigy.
- Montreux Jazz Festival (July): A world-renowned jazz festival held on the shores of Lake Geneva.
- Swiss National Day (August 1): A celebration of Swiss independence with fireworks, parades, and traditional food.
- Lucerne Festival (August/September): A classical music festival featuring top orchestras and soloists from around the world.
- Autumn Wine Festivals (September/October): Celebrations of the grape harvest in various wine regions, with tastings, parades, and traditional food.
- Christmas Markets (November/December): Festive markets with stalls selling handicrafts, food, and drinks.
Attending one of these events or festivals can add a unique and memorable dimension to your trip to Switzerland.

17. What are Some Important Phrases to Know in Swiss Languages?
Knowing some basic phrases in the local languages can enhance your travel experience in Switzerland, even if English is widely spoken in tourist areas. Here are some important phrases to know in German, French, and Italian:
Phrase | German (Swiss German) | French | Italian |
---|---|---|---|
Hello | Grüezi | Bonjour | Ciao |
Goodbye | Adieu | Au revoir | Arrivederci |
Thank you | Merci | Merci | Grazie |
You’re welcome | Gern geschehen | De rien | Prego |
Please | Bitte | S’il vous plaît | Per favore |
Excuse me | Entschuldigung | Excusez-moi | Scusi |
How much does it cost? | Wieviel kostet das? | Combien coûte? | Quanto costa? |
Do you speak English? | Sprechen Sie Englisch? | Parlez-vous Anglais? | Parla inglese? |
Learning these basic phrases can help you communicate more effectively with locals and show your respect for their culture.

22. How Can Tourists Find Information About Public Transportation Schedules in Switzerland?
Switzerland has an excellent public transportation system, and finding information about schedules is relatively easy. Here are some resources for finding public transportation schedules:
- SBB Website: The Swiss Federal Railways (SBB) website (sbb.ch) provides comprehensive information about train schedules, routes, and ticket prices.
- SBB Mobile App: The SBB Mobile app allows you to search for train schedules, buy tickets, and track your journey in real-time.
- Local Tourist Information Centers: Local tourist information centers can provide information about bus, tram, and boat schedules in their respective areas.
- Google Maps: Google Maps provides public transportation directions and schedules in Switzerland.
- Public Transportation Websites: Many local public transportation companies have websites with schedule information.
By using these resources, you can easily find information about public transportation schedules and plan your journeys efficiently.
23. What are Some Important Safety Tips for Tourists in Switzerland?
Switzerland is generally a safe country for tourists, but it is always wise to take precautions to protect yourself and your belongings. Here are some important safety tips for tourists in Switzerland:
- Be Aware of Your Surroundings: Pay attention to your surroundings and be mindful of potential hazards, such as pickpockets and traffic.
- Protect Your Belongings: Keep your valuables in a safe place, such as a hotel safe or a concealed pouch.
- Avoid Walking Alone at Night: Avoid walking alone in poorly lit or isolated areas at night.
- Be Careful When Hiking: Wear appropriate footwear and clothing when hiking, and be aware of weather conditions and trail hazards.
- Follow Local Laws and Regulations: Respect local laws and regulations, and be aware of potential fines or penalties for violations.
- Be Prepared for Emergencies: Know how to contact emergency services in Switzerland (police: 117, fire: 118, ambulance: 144).
- Purchase Travel Insurance: Purchase travel insurance to protect yourself against unexpected medical expenses, trip cancellations, and other unforeseen events.
By following these safety tips, you can minimize your risk of encountering problems and enjoy a safe and worry-free trip to Switzerland.

25. What are Some Popular Day Trips from Major Cities in Switzerland?
Taking day trips from major cities in Switzerland is a great way to explore the country’s diverse landscapes and attractions. Here are some popular day trips from Zurich, Geneva, and Lucerne:
-
From Zurich:
- Rhine Falls: Europe’s largest waterfall.
- Lucerne: A picturesque city on Lake Lucerne.
- Stein am Rhein: A charming medieval town on the Rhine River.
-
From Geneva:
- Chamonix: A mountain resort town in the French Alps, at the foot of Mont Blanc.
- Lausanne: A city on Lake Geneva with a beautiful cathedral and Olympic Museum.
- Gruyères: A medieval town known for its cheese.
-
From Lucerne:
- Mount Rigi: A mountain with panoramic views of the Swiss Alps.
- Mount Titlis: A mountain with a glacier and revolving gondola.
- Bern: The Swiss capital, a UNESCO World Heritage site.
